Default Port&Polish = Lower CR??

HI guys, I have a quick question, Im building my b18c1, and just got a complete built gsr head and valvetrain from portflow, I was thinking of runnin p30 .50 oversized pistons from rs machines on my block, with oem headgasket, which would put me about 11.5-11.7 CR, the other day I went to a shop where there was this tuner, and I told him about my plans, he said to get CTR pistons if I want to run that kind of CR because with the port and polished head work, that be knocking about .5 from the CR.

Normally with CTR pistons i'd have 12.2:1 CR but because of the P&P head I'd be running around 11.7; this is what the guy told me but I wasnt that sure, tried doing a search but nothing came out.

Default Re: Port&Polish = Lower CR?? (Eg6DR)

Unless Tom opened up your combustion chambers, your compression ratio will be unchanged. Stick with the P30 pistons; PCT pistons are not great.

Default Re: Port&Polish = Lower CR?? (Eg6DR)

1) Don't get hung up on compression. Ask you self this question, does higher compression make your head flow anymore? Compression is a 2nd order effect. Having a higher flowing head is what is actually important.

2) Don't switch to CTR pistons in a GSR, there are many reasons not to. Search you find the answers as to why.
